The epitome of scruffy East End cool, the Star of Bethnal Green attracts a young, up-for-it crowd and blends a laid-back pub vibe with the edgy music policy of London's best clubs. A bold red and silver star stamps the wall behind the stage, and there are low-key gigs from big bands and an eclectic-yet-funky line-up of disco, house and indie nights. Watch out for madcap bash Bastard Batty Bass on monthly Thursdays, led by DJ Hannah Holland and various free or super-cheap (£5 max) sessions from Europe's best underground DJs such as Mark 7, Ray Mang and Mulletover resident Geddes. The Tuesday night quiz is a big hit with locals and the lure of free food helps too. Sundays are all about their tasty roasts served up with ironic pop and yacht rock.
